Iran's cotton import a bane for domestic cotton
18 Mar '06
1 min read
Iran has imported 40000 ton cotton with similar quantities lying in its domestic cotton factories.
Iran's Agriculture Minister, Mohammad Reza Eskandari said if cotton import continued, domestic problems would increase.
Iran Government and Agriculture Ministry's main program was to support domestic productions.
Even Iran's Government has approved of domestic needs be satisfied with domestic productions and imports be reduced, he said.
